MS Gohthard: A Rural Primary School in Anantnag, Jammu and Kashmir

MS Gohthard, a government-run primary school in Anantnag district, Jammu and Kashmir, stands as a testament to rural education. Established in 1974 under the Department of Education, this co-educational institution serves students from Class 1 to Class 8, providing a crucial educational foundation for the community.

Academic Excellence and Infrastructure:

The school boasts four classrooms, ensuring a conducive learning environment for its students. The curriculum is delivered in English, fostering multilingual capabilities. A notable feature is the inclusion of a pre-primary section, catering to the youngest learners and providing a smooth transition into formal education. The school's library houses an impressive collection of 240 books, enriching the learning experience beyond the classroom. Furthermore, access to tap water ensures the students' basic needs are met. Ramps for disabled children are available, reflecting the school's commitment to inclusivity.

Teaching Staff and Educational Approach:

MS Gohthard employs a dedicated team of five teachers, comprising three male and two female educators, ensuring a balanced approach to instruction. The school prepares and provides meals on-site, addressing the nutritional needs of its students and enhancing their overall well-being. While the school has a library and provides meals, the lack of electricity and a boundary wall present challenges. The absence of computer-aided learning facilities also indicates a need for technological upgrades to enhance the learning experience. The absence of a playground highlights the need for improved recreational spaces that support holistic student development.
